Manipur: Schools Closed Till July 24 As State Witnesses Surge In New COVID-19 Cases

“As Covid-19 cases increase and the test positivity rate ratio is over 15 per cent in the state, all schools (Govt/Private) of the state will remain closed till July 24,” a notification issued by the Manipur government stated.

All schools in Manipur have been asked to remain close until July 24 due to a dramatic increase of new COVID19 cases in the state, according to Imphal. On Tuesday, the Manipuri government issued directives in this regard. All public and private schools in the state will be closed through July 24 because of the rising number of Covid-19 instances and the state’s test positivity rate ratio, which is already over 15%.


The state health bulletin stated that Manipur on Tuesday recorded 59 new COVID-19 cases, whereas, on Monday, 47 people tested positive.
Manipur also saw 15 recoveries in the previous 24 hours, according to the State’s Directorate of Health Services. While the state has seen 57,264 recoveries. In the state with a 15.6% COVID-19 positivity rate, 2,120 persons have already died from the virus.


The number of Coronavirus cases in India rose by 13,615 in the previous day, bringing the total to 4,36,52,944. While there have been 20 more fatalities in the past 24 hours, bringing the total death toll to 5,25,474.
According to data from the Union Health Ministry, the number of active cases rose to 1,31,043. The Ministry reported that the national COVID-19 recovery rate was recorded at 98.50%, while the active cases make up 0.30 percent of all infections.

An increase of 330 cases has been recorded in the active COVID-19 caseload in a span of 24 hours.
